Ukrainian Modern Metallers Aftermoon announce 2018 European tour

22/4/2018

0 Comments

 
Picture

Modern metal act Aftermoon (Kiev) are proud to announce their European Tour 2018.

About Aftermoon live shows:

      "Our shows are always different as well as our songs. Aftermoon concert program can be very sensual and calm and can consist our lyrical songs, acoustic versions of Aftermoon`s tracks and even covers-versions of the greatest hits. On the contrary, it can be a heavy-metal show, where clean vocals changes to extreme techniques, gentle piano sound transforms into aggressive and hard synths. However, usually it all comes together into a wild vortex of emotions, music, feelings and drive."

Picture

Aftermoon is a modern metal band from Kiev, Ukraine. We've started our musical way in 2012. Since the band's formation, Aftermoon has played more than 80 shows in Europe and the biggest Ukrainian cities. We explore different genres in our music, such as modern metal, alternative rock and crossover. Symbiosis of different styles: we combine melodic vocals and piano with hard guitar riffs and intense rhythm section, use classical techniques and the variety of modern sound to create a unique mix that exists on the border of various musical genres. This allows Aftermoon find listeners with different musical preferences, both extreme metal and soft rock fans.

Danish heavy is more than Volbeat :); all Danish-band tour announced

21/4/2018

0 Comments

 
Picture

The Danish heavy scene is on fire these days. The small country best know for H.C. Andersen, Volbeat and beating Germany at the 92' European championship, are experiencing a boost of talent not seen since the hay days of 2003-2006 with Hatesphere, Raunchy, Mnemic and more.

This is your chance to get on board the new wave of Danish hard rock & metal. This all Danish package includes:

  • Defecto who have supported Rammstein and Metallica in 2017 and currently heaped as one of the most popular heavy bands in Denmark.
 
  • Helhorse who have been touring Europe immensely and supporting the likes of Slayer, AC/DC, and Phil Campbell.
 
  • Not to forget Siamese the award winning hard rockers which just recently hit over 4 million streams for their latest album Shameless.
 
  • Finally we have the young guns Aphyxion who still today hold the record for being the youngest band ever to play Wacken Open Air and Copenhell at the age of 16.

Come and see what Denmark is up to these days. You will not regret it.

England's The Raven Age joins Killswitch Engage, Shinedown & Tremonti on tour this summer

21/4/2018

0 Comments

 
Picture

Following the announcement of the arrival of new vocalist Matt James (ex-Wild Lies) and fresh from their UK tour with Savage Messiah, breaking UK metallers The Raven Age have confirmed they will be supporting heavy-weights Killswitch Engage on their European tour this summer, which kicks off next month in Sweden.
 
In addition to a number of dates already announced with legends Iron Maiden, The Raven Age will also be joining Shinedown for a show in Germany on June 6th, Tremonti for a date in Holland on June 26thand will being playing main stage slots at this year’s Graspop, Hellfest and Volt Festivals, amongst others.
 
Their relentless touring schedule only builds on their already impressive portfolio of over 250 live shows played worldwide, which includes their first European headline run, support slots with acts including Anthrax, Gojira, Mastodon and Ghost, as well as appearances at Wacken Open Air, Rock Am Ring/Rock Im Park and Download UK.
 
The band, formed of new addition Matt James (vocals), guitarists George Harris and Tony Maue, bassist Matt Cox and drummer Jai Patel, have been tipped as “the UK’s next brightest metal hope” by Metal Hammer and were Planet Rock’s ‘Best New Band’ award winners in 2017, following the release of their debut album Darkness Will Rise. They’ve now just released their first taste of new music with frontman Matt, with the new single ‘Surrogate’ - WATCH THE VIDEO HERE
 
They are now set to continue their global rise at the forefront of a new wave of British metal acts with a second album in the works and the US in their sights.

England's De Profundis announce Summer UK tour and Bloodstock Festival appearance

21/4/2018

0 Comments

 
Picture

The new album from De Profundis, The Blinding Light Of Faith, will be released through Transcending Obscurity Records on May 10th. The media reception to this darkest, heaviest release by one of the UK’s finest death metal bands has been nothing short of rapturous and tracks that have premiered at sites like Metal Injection and Decibel Magazine have created a huge sense of anticipation for the album’s release.

Now there is even more for death metal fans to look forward to, as De Profundis announce their first leg of touring in support of The Blinding Light Of Faith. Today we can reveal the details of a six date headlining UK tour, by arrangement with Artery Global and in association with Zero Tolerance Magazine, taking in Manchester, Glasgow, Ipswich, Plymouth and London – as well as an appearance at the mighty Bloodstock Open Air festival with Judas Priest and Emperor. Emirati Death Metallers Nervecell announce Asia Tour 2018 dates

12/4/2018

0 Comments

 
Picture
Dubai-based death metallers Nervecell announced their upcoming Asia tour Torture Over Asia 2018. Commented the band: 

     "We are looking forward to kicking off our 2018 touring cycle promoting our new album "Past, Present...Torture" in Asia next month. Although we've done a few Asian tours before, this run is special considering these shows will be our first live appearances since the release of the new album, and also because it will be our first time performing in countries such as Taiwan, Vietnam and Malaysia where we have never been to before. So if you are in any of the cities we'll be stopping by, be sure to come out and have a night of metal mayhem with us. See you there!".

Japanese metallers Saber Tiger announce Eastern Europe Devastation Tour

10/4/2018

0 Comments

 
Picture

Classic Japanese metallists Saber Tiger will embark on their first full tour of Eastern Europe in May and June. The group will be taking the Devastation Tour for 12 shows touching base in Russia, Ukraine, Latvia and Lithuania. This is a great chance for European audiences to see one of the best Asian heavy metal bands around with a set based around their latest, and possibly best album,  Bystander Effect.

The release of Bystander Effect is not just a simple re-issue for the international market; four of the tracks, originally in Japanese, have been re-recorded with English lyrics, while the brand new acoustic instrumental Ship Of Theseus and a new recording of the Saber Tiger classic First Class Fool are exclusive to the Sliptrick Records release. Also, demo recordings of the spectacular tracks Sin Eater and What I Used To Be are included. There is no better way to get acquainted with Saber Tiger’s unique brand of heavy metal.
